Wear-resistant steel balls—what are the classifications of steel balls for ball mills?
2010-06-24
Wear-resistant steel balls, as an indispensable component (grinding media) of ball mills, are undoubtedly the largest consumable wear-resistant material in the global comminution industry—both today and for the foreseeable future. In 2008, the mineral processing sector alone in China consumed approximately 2 million tonnes of steel balls made from various materials, while the Chinese cement industry is projected to consume a record-breaking 200,000 tonnes in 2009.
Steel ball grading for cement mills
After the mill has been in operation for a period of time, balls must be replenished every 7 to 10 days, which can lead to a highly disordered ball-size distribution. The longer the mill operates, the more ball sizes are present, making it increasingly difficult to accurately calculate the ball-size distribution. When a small mill is emptied for maintenance, the ball mix can be carefully calculated and the balls sorted by size before being added, ensuring that the resulting size distribution closely matches the calculated values.
